Supernatural Detectives 3: Experiences of Flaxman Low / Some Experiences of Lord Syfret
Supernatural Detectives 3 collects the 12 cases of ghostly encounters and strange deaths with Flaxman Low, psychic investigator, (created by Hesketh Prichard and his mother, Kate Prichard, under the pseudonyms E. and H. Heron), and the 7 stories of Lord Syfret, created by Arabella Kenealy. Lord Syfret is a low-key supernatural investigator, usually only receiving strange "impressions" that may lead to interesting people, but sometimes encounters true horror.
